To add more to it, another feather was added to Kerala’s hat when the New York Times report listed the southern Indian State among the 52 places to go in 2023. It need not be mentioned that Kerala is celebrated for its beaches, backwater lagoons, mouth-watering cuisine, and rich cultural traditions including the Vaikathashtami festival.
Apart from all these, there are much more things that attract the eyeballs of tourists including hill stations, commercial cities, hamlets, etc.

When talking about the charming land, Kumarakom is something that must be mentioned as the serene beauty attracts a fair number of people here. The alluring scenarios, exotic flora and fauna definitely make it one of the loveliest tourist places.
The tourists can try a number of activities here ranging from paddling through jungly canals to weaving rope from coconut fiber. One may even learn to climb a palm tree here.
Visitors in Maravanthuruthu can easily follow a storytelling trail and enjoy every bit of the village street art. They are also open to witness evening the performance of traditional temple dance.
As per the NYT report, one may note that London, Morioka, Palm Springs, and Greenville, among other places, were included in the list of 52 places where one can travel in 2023, and it is a matter of pride for our country. All thanks to God’s own country Kerala and the beauty it beholds.
